I have a boinc system that runs Einstein at home just fine on my vega56, so I'm fairly confident the base system works. But the milkyway@home client strangly fails to find the device:

./milkyway_1.46_x86_64-pc-linux-gnu__opencl_ati_101 -l 0 -d 0 --verbose -g
22:52:54 (3499): Can't open init data file - running in standalone mode
<search_application> milkyway_separation 1.46 Linux x86_64 double OpenCL </search_application>
Guessing preferred OpenCL vendor 'Advanced Micro Devices, Inc.'
Error loading Lua script 'astronomy_parameters.txt': [string "number_parameters: 4..."]:1: '<name>' expected near '4' 
Switching to Parameter File 'astronomy_parameters.txt'
<number_WUs> 1 </number_WUs>
<number_params_per_WU> 20 </number_params_per_WU>
CPU features:        SSE2 = 1, SSE3 = 1, SSE4.1 = 1, AVX = 1
Available functions: SSE2 = 1, SSE3 = 1, SSE4.1 = 1, AVX = 1
Forcing:             SSE2 = 0, SSE3 = 0, SSE4.1 = 0, AVX = 0
Using AVX path
Found 1 platform
Platform 0 information:
  Name:       AMD Accelerated Parallel Processing
  Version:    OpenCL 2.1 AMD-APP (2949.0)
  Vendor:     Advanced Micro Devices, Inc.
  Extensions: cl_khr_icd cl_amd_event_callback cl_amd_offline_devices 
  Profile:    FULL_PROFILE
Using device 0 on platform 0
Failed to find number of devices (-1): CL_DEVICE_NOT_FOUND
Failed to get information about device
Error getting device and context (1): MW_CL_ERROR
Failed to calculate likelihood
22:52:54 (3499): called boinc_finish(1)

but clinfo run (as the boinc user, so I don't think it's a permissions error) seems to work just fine:

The machine is running ubuntu 19.04 with amd's official rocm 2.7 packages installed for both opencl and hsa. Again, einstein runs just fine on the same machine. Happy to do simple debugging if it'll help.
